Massachusetts Financial Services (MFS), founded in 1924 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is a pioneering investment management firm credited with launching the first U.S. mutual fund, the Massachusetts Investors Trust. Managing hundreds of billions in assets, MFS offers a wide range of actively managed investment products, including equity, fixed-income, and balanced funds, serving institutional investors, financial advisors, and individuals globally. Known for its disciplined, research-driven approach, the firm emphasizes long-term value creation through fundamental analysis and a collaborative team structure, avoiding short-term market trends. With a legacy of innovation and a strong global presence, MFS remains a respected name in the asset management industry, balancing tradition with a focus on sustainable, client-centric investing.

Massachusetts Financial Services's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Massachusetts Financial Services held 1,005 positions worth $298B, down 4.1% from $310B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Massachusetts Financial Services withdrew a net $20.7B in Q1 2026, closing 62 positions and reducing 565 holdings. Its most notable exit was Exact Sciences, an estimated $277M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

Against the trend, Massachusetts Financial Services opened a new position in Comcast worth $306M.
